Themed Attractions

Products and Services


From Master plan to execution. The creative design process moves the imagination to reality. MORE

Set Building and Construction

RMA are a one stop shop for themed attractions and thus carry out all set building and construction. MORE


Bringing the unusual to life.  All aspects of a project can be themed, sometimes to disguise or to provide a more durable finish. MORE


Video and Audio productions bring content to life enabling a vast array of media. MORE


is the use of electronics and robotics in mechanised puppets to simulate life. MORE

Special Effects

All projects no matter the size require background technology to bring the concept to life. MORE

Set Lighting

RMA brings the creative product to life, with sensitive, space appropriate lighting fixtures. MORE